Landscaping services for banks typically involve designing, installing, and maintaining outdoor areas that create a professional and welcoming appearance. These services can include planting trees, shrubs, and flowers, installing lawns or turf, and adding features like walkways, lighting, and decorative elements. The goal is to enhance the property's curb appeal while ensuring the landscape remains functional and attractive over time. Bank landscaping often requires careful planning to align with branding and security needs, making it essential to work with experienced local contractors who understand the specific requirements of commercial properties.
Many common problems that bank landscaping services help solve include overgrown or unkempt grounds, erosion issues, and areas that lack visual appeal. Poorly maintained landscapes can give a negative impression to customers and visitors, potentially impacting the bank’s reputation. Additionally, landscaping can address practical concerns such as drainage problems or uneven terrain that pose safety hazards. By investing in professional landscaping, banks can create a tidy, inviting environment that encourages trust and confidence from clients and community members.

The overview below groups typical Bank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Dallas,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Landscaping Repairs - Typical costs for routine landscaping repairs, such as fixing damaged lawns or replacing small plants, generally range from $250 to $600. Many projects fall into this middle range, with fewer repairs reaching the higher end depending on scope and materials.
Mid-Size Landscaping Projects - Installing new flower beds, adding mulch, or planting shrubs us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common among local contractors handling moderate landscaping enhancements for homes and businesses.
Large Landscaping Installations - Extensive work like new lawn installation, irrigation systems, or large tree planting can cost $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her tiers, but many projects remain in the mid-range.
Full Landscape Replacement - Complete overhaul or redesign of a landscape can range from $10,000 to $25,000+ depending on size and features. While fewer projects reach this level, local service providers can handle these comprehensive jobs for properties requiring significant transformation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ing landscaping service providers in Dallas and nearby areas, it’s important to consider their experience with projects similar to what is needed. Homeowners should inquire about the types of landscaping jobs local contractors have handled in the past, ensuring they have relevant experience that aligns with the scope of the project. A contractor’s familiarity with local soil conditions, climate considerations, and design preferences can contribute to a smoother process and a result that meets expectations.
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. Homeowners should seek detailed descriptions of the scope of work, including materials, design elements, and project milestones. Having these details documented hel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. Reputable contractors often provide written estimates or proposals that outline the work involved, making it easier to compare options and choose a provider that aligns with the homeowner’s vision.
Effective communication and reputable references are key indicators of a dependable local contractor.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references from previous clients who had similar projects completed, to gain insight into the contractor’s reliability and quality of work. Good communication involves prompt responses to questions, transparency about processes, and a willingness to discuss ideas and concerns openly.
